Do you have eggs for breakfast? Breakfast is an important meal because good food
gives you energy for your day. Eggs give you energy, so they are a popular
breakfast food around the world.
In Russia, there are often eggs for breakfast. Sandwiches, pancakes and kasha – a
type of cereal – are popular, too. People usually have tea or coffee with breakfast.
Eggs are popular for breakfast in England. A “traditional” English breakfast has got
eggs with sausages, beans, potatoes and tomatoes.
Eggs, bread and coffee aren’t popular in China. There’s bing – a type of pancake
and there’s tang – a type of soup. They’ve got a cereal called zhou, too.
There are many different types of breakfasts around the world, but eggs or no eggs,
breakfast is an important meal.
